The number of people killed in the latest cholera outbreak in Angola has reached 150, the Health Ministry has said. A total of 4,235 people have been infected since early January, the ministry said.

Toyo Engineering Corp. will license its proprietary urea technology for Amufert S.A.'s 4,000-tpd urea plant to be built in the Soyo region of the Republic of Angola.
